摘 要:目的:用反相高效液相色谱法测定吴茱萸及其炮制品中绿原酸的含量,探讨不同炮制方法对于吴茱萸中绿原酸含量的影响。方法:采用Diamonsil C_(18)色谱柱(250 mm×4.6 mm,5μm);流动相:乙腈-0.4%磷酸水溶液等度洗脱;流速:1.0 ml·min^(-1):检测波长:327 nm;柱温:25℃。结果:吴茱萸不同炮制品绿原酸的含量较吴茱萸生品均有不同程度的降低。结论:浸泡制炮制方法比浸润制炮制方法对于绿原酸含量的降低作用更大。Objective: To explore the different processing methods on the content changes of ehlorogenic acid in Evodia and pro- cessed products by RP-HPLC. Method: Dimonsil C18column (250 mm ×4.6 mm,5 μm) was used. The mobile phase was acetonitrile-0.4% phosphate water solution with gradient elution. The flow rate was 1 ml·min 1. The detection wavelength was at 327 μm and the column temperature was 25 ℃ Result: The contents of chlorogenic acid in Evodia and processed products was different, which in the processed products were lower than Evodia. Conclusion: The contents of chlorogenie acid with immersion system is lower than infiltration system.
